Hangzhou - Linping
As an important node of the Grand Canal cultural belt, Linping, known for its long histroy of “hustle and bustle” and foods’ variety, has formed its unique water town culinary culture and is home to numerous culinary stories. Among them, the most representative ones are Braised mutton in brown sauce, Tangxi duck, Sheeptail dessert, and Sticky rice meatball. The Braised mutton in brown sauce in Linping is made with high-quality Huzhou sheep as the food material, and is slowly stewed with private techniques. It tastes soft and suitable for all ages. Tangqi duck, after being smoked, roasted, and cooked, has a bright red color, a fresh and tender taste, and a refreshing and delicious aroma. Sheeptail dessert is mainly made of pork fat and red bean paste, which are crispy on the outside and sticky on the inside after deep frying, sweet but not greasy; Due to its resemblance to a sheep tail, hence the name of the dish. The sticky rice meatball made of fresh meat and glutinous rice is slightly larger than the table tennis ball. Because the sticky glutinous rice on the meatballs sticks up like a hedgehog, people call it "hedgehog" as "thorn hair", so it is named "thorn hair meatballs", and later "Sticky rice Meatballs".
